GIRLS ON THE RUN OF DAYTON, founded in 2010, is a small nonprofit in the Youth Development sector that reported $383K in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. Revenue surged 46% from the prior year, signaling strong growth momentum.

Mission

CHARACTER DEVELOPMENT PROGRAM FOR YOUTH GIRLS; TO INSPIRE THEM TO BE JOYFUL, HEALTHY AND CONFIDENT USING A FUN, EXPERIENCE-BASED CURRICULUM WHICH CREATIVELY INTEGRATES RUNNING.
